Your gym’s floor is far more significant than many people think. The right flooring will protect your equipment, keep you safe and give your space a professional look. The Best Material For Gym Flooring is rubber as it is tough, bouncy and simple to clean. The style of rubber flooring you decide on for your gym will have a huge impact on how it looks and feels.
Rubber flooring is becoming commonly used among people, no longer restricted to commercial gyms but also to be used at home for working out. It can withstand heavy weights, foot traffic and resistance training. Rubber gym flooring is becoming more and more popular as it offers a less reflective surface than softer floors, absorbs sound, and also gives your gym members a safe floor when training.

Rubber is popular for a lot of gym flooring applications. In weightlifting areas, it guards the floor from dropped weights. In cardio zones, it muffles the whine of treadmills and bikes. In yoga and stretching rooms, it provides a soft and safe surface. It is not even harmful for Home Gyms since it protects the house flooring too.
A few things are necessary to consider when Selecting Rubber Flooring for your gym. Floor thickness will matter if you’re lifting heavy weights or have lots of people getting in workouts. The length of time your material lasts is determined by its quality. The design and color should coordinate with your gym’s design. It is also important to look at the ease of maintenance. A desirable one will combine durability, safety, and looks.
Caring for your flooring will ensure a longer, like-new appearance. Filth won’t accumulate if you clean them every day with a mop or vacuum. Occasionally deep cleaning can help as well to keep things clean. Rubber floors are inherently stain-resistant but a sealant can offer additional protection. With proper care, rubber flooring will stand up to heavy use in a gym over many years.

Safety first, in all gyms. Rubber is slip-resistant, even when wet. It also reduces the impact, decreasing the probability of injury with even high-intensity workouts or lifting weights. This makes it a great option for novice and pro athletes.
The thudding of weights dropping and machines running is one of the principal problems in gyms. Rubber is great for suppressing sound and vibrations. This provides a more enjoyable workout experience for members and decreases noise in the club, particularly in residential or shared use environments.

For home gyms, you need only 6mm to 8mm. For commercial gyms or high-traffic weightlifting and heavy equipment areas, you may need as much as 10mm to 15mm (or more) thickness for durability and shock absorption.
Rubber floor can be broken down into tiles, rolls and Mats Dubai. Tiles are a breeze to swap out; rolls spread out over large stretches, so there are fewer seams, and mats can be moved around. Perfect for those zones underneath or in front of equipment where you want cushioning but don’t need universal coverage.
